I recently sent my SilencerCo Sparrow back to the factory for the Stainless Steel baffle upgrade.
One of the benefits of the upgrade is the ability to use my .22LR suppressor for 17 HMR.
Of course, that meant I had to have a 17 HMR rifle. In my never ending search, I could not find a model with a threaded barrel, so I decided to buy a model I liked, and send it off to be threaded.
I found a Savage bull barrel with a really nice thumb-hole stock that I liked, so I grabbed it up.
I sent the barrel to ADCO firearms for the work. Had the barrel cut down to 18", threaded for my suppressor, and a thread protector made from the original barrel.
Added a Sweet 17 scope, looking for a nice bi-pod, and I think I will be all ready to go.
